The Birth of a Nation (1915) is a milestone in cinematic history. Directed by D.W. Griffith, it is widely considered the most technically brilliant and socially reprehensible film ever made. The Birth of a Nation (1915) - IMDb
: The film features white actors in blackface portraying Black people as unintelligent, aggressive, and predatory.
